What Is Body Fat Percentage and Why Does It Matter?

Body fat percentage (BFP) refers to the proportion of your total body weight made up of fat tissue, including essential fat and stored fat. Unlike BMI (Body Mass Index), which uses just height and weight and often overlooks muscle mass, BFP more accurately reflects your health status. Excess body fat, particularly visceral fat stored around internal organs, increases risks for type 2 diabetes, cardiovascular disease, and certain cancers.[1] Conversely, too little body fat can impair hormone production, energy regulation, and immune function. Optimizing BFP within scientifically supported ranges enhances metabolic resilience, supports physical and cognitive function, and improves longevity.[2]

Ideal Body Fat Percentage for Busy Professionals

Optimal body fat ranges vary by age, sex, and activity level. For high-performing knowledge workers aged 25–45 aiming for longevity, general guidelines are:

  • Men: 10–20% body fat
  • Women: 18–28% body fat

Staying within these ranges supports hormone balance, cognitive function, and immune health without sacrificing energy availability or muscular strength. Very low body fat (under 6% men, 12% women) risks metabolic slowdown and impaired resilience, while high body fat (>25% men, >32% women) increases chronic disease risk.[3]

How to Accurately Measure Body Fat Percentage

Several methods exist to gauge body fat percentage, balancing accuracy, cost, and convenience:

  • DEXA Scan: Gold-standard medical imaging assessing bone density, lean mass, and fat mass. Quick (10–20 min) and highly precise. Centenary Day’s article on DEXA scans explains how to integrate this test with personalized plans.
  • Bioelectrical Impedance Analysis (BIA): Affordable, home-friendly devices estimate fat mass via electrical resistance. Accuracy depends on hydration and device quality.
  • Skinfold Calipers: Skilled measurement of subcutaneous fat at standardized sites. Affordable but requires expertise.
  • Hydrostatic Weighing and Bod Pod: Lab-based methods using water displacement or air volume; accurate but less accessible.

Why Monitoring Body Fat Matters for Longevity

Excess fat tissue secretes inflammatory cytokines and disrupts insulin sensitivity, accelerating age-related chronic diseases. Maintaining healthy body fat percentage reduces systemic inflammation and supports cardiovascular health. Higher muscle-to-fat ratios also improve mobility, metabolic rate, and mental wellbeing—key factors for sustained performance and quality of life.[3] Moreover, when combined with biomarker monitoring of related parameters (e.g., blood lipids, insulin resistance markers), it creates a holistic picture empowering proactive adjustments in exercise and nutrition.

Science-Backed Strategies to Optimize Body Fat

Here are efficient, evidence-based tactics suited for busy professionals:

  • Personalized Nutrition Plans: Employ calorie and macronutrient adjustments guided by body fat and routine goals to preserve lean mass while reducing excess fat.
  • High-Intensity Interval Training (HIIT): Brief, intense exercise sessions improve fat oxidation and metabolic rate effectively in limited time.[5]
  • Resistance Training: Builds muscle mass that elevates resting metabolism and supports healthy body composition. Learn more with Centenary Day’s resistance training guide.
  • Consistent Sleep and Stress Management: Poor sleep and chronic stress elevate cortisol, which promotes fat storage, especially visceral fat.

Frequently Asked Questions

How often should I measure body fat percentage?

For meaningful tracking without obsession, measuring every 4–6 weeks is practical. This balances observing real changes while avoiding fluctuations from hydration or measurement error.

Can body fat percentage be too low for longevity?

Yes. Extremely low body fat can impair hormone production, immune function, and energy metabolism. Maintaining essential fat levels—about 3% for men and 10–13% for women—is crucial.

Does muscle weigh more than fat?

Muscle is denser than fat, so equal volumes differ in weight. That’s why weight alone isn’t enough to assess health; body fat percentage provides clearer insight.

How does visceral fat impact health?

Visceral fat surrounds organs and is metabolically active, secreting pro-inflammatory factors linked to insulin resistance, cardiovascular disease, and reduced longevity.

Is it necessary to buy expensive devices to measure body fat?

No. While DEXA provides the most detail, many effective methods like BIA scales and calipers are affordable and accessible. The key is consistency and integrating measurements with a personalized plan.
